Table of Contents
9 Ways KanBo Revolutionizes Software Engineering Leadership for Complex Challenges
Introduction: Rediscovering the Harmony of Work
Once upon a time in the world of software engineering, projects glided effortlessly through the stages of development, much like a beautifully choreographed ballet. Deadlines were met with the precision of a master clockmaker, and the work environment thrummed with a harmonious energy that felt as natural as breathing. Those days, now seemingly distant, evoke a sense of nostalgia for an era where everything clicked into place. But as the tempo of the business environment has accelerated, the symphony of synchronized efforts has often been thrown into disarray.
In today's fast-paced world, the once seamless synergy has become a cacophony of overlapping tasks, scattered communications, and missed deadlines. The demands of rapid technological advancement and globalization have disrupted the sense of order and efficiency we once took for granted. It's like an orchestra trying to perform without a conductor—individual talents are there, but without direction, the music lacks cohesion.
Enter KanBo, a modern maestro ready to restore that lost symphony of work. Much like a skilled conductor who unites diverse instruments to create a masterpiece, KanBo orchestrates every element of your projects, aligning them into perfect harmony. For Directors of Software Engineering, particularly within the high-stakes banking industry, this is not just desirable—it’s essential. KanBo provides a structured platform that brings clarity, rhythm, and elegance back to the cadence of work. It bridges strategy with daily operations, ensuring that each note—the tasks, the timelines, the communications—unfolds in order, resulting in a concert of productivity and satisfaction.
As you navigate the complexities of today’s business environment, let KanBo be the baton that restores efficiency and order to your professional symphony, allowing you to reminisce on the golden days of yore while fully embracing the future.
Embracing Context with KanBo Cards
In the realm of software engineering, especially within sectors that demand precision and coordination, the challenge of aligning tasks with the broader objectives can sometimes feel like piecing together a complex puzzle. However, KanBo Technology empowers businesses to manage these complexities with effortless grace, akin to the simple pleasure of paging through a compelling narrative.
KanBo's Holistic Approach to Task and Workflow Management
KanBo is not merely a task management tool; it is an ecosystem that places every task, process, and workflow within the broader strategic objectives of an organization. It does so by integrating distinct projects and discrete activities into a cohesive structure that reflects the overarching goals of the enterprise.
KanBo Cards as Context and Memory
The essence of KanBo's efficiency lies in its use of KanBo Cards. Each card serves as a repository of context and memory, capturing every piece of information and every activity that relates to a task since its inception. These features ensure that KanBo Cards function as living entities that grow and evolve with the project, much like characters in a narrative who develop through the chapters of a book.
- Comprehensive Information Capture: Each KanBo Card encapsulates vital information such as notes, files, comments, and checklists. This means that from the moment a task is created, its entire lifecycle is documented, creating a rich tapestry of context around each unit of work.
- Dynamic Activity Streams: The inclusion of a real-time activity stream provides users with a chronological log of all actions, updated continuously. This ensures Directors of Software Engineering have immediate access to the progress and history of any card at any given moment, extending transparency and immediate context.
- Interconnected Card Relations: With features such as parent-child and next-previous card relations, KanBo allows users to parse large projects into smaller, manageable tasks while maintaining clear relationships and dependencies. This structured clarity prevents miscommunication and aligns execution with strategy.
Simplification for Software Engineering Directors
For the Director of Software Engineering, managing complex projects can often feel like juggling an overwhelming number of priorities all at once. KanBo simplifies this process by offering an intuitive structure that transforms multifaceted projects into a synchronized series of steps, much like chapters that seamlessly follow one another in a well-written book.
- Structured Workspace and Spaces: KanBo deploys a system of Workspaces and Spaces to group related projects and tasks, making navigation and collaboration instinctive. This enables directors to quickly align teams with strategic goals, ensuring every member understands how their efforts contribute to the larger picture.
- User-Specific Responsibilities: By assigning specific card users with clear roles — such as Person Responsible or Co-Worker — accountability becomes transparent. This clarity helps prevent overlaps, optimizes resource allocation, and keeps teams aligned to the project’s objectives.
KanBo reshapes the chaotic milieu of contemporary project management into a coherent, fluid experience. For leaders in software engineering, it means turning the complex tapestry of innovation, deadlines, and deliverables into a seamless progression that feels as intuitively structured as reading through a well-organized narrative. By capturing context and providing transparent operations, KanBo reinstates the harmony and purposeful stride of a well-coordinated marine.
Pioneering the Future: Solving Complex Problems with KanBo
KanBo as the Digital Infrastructure for Resolving Complex Challenges in Modern Organizations
In an era where businesses face unprecedented challenges, KanBo emerges as a digital infrastructure that powerfully streamlines and transforms the operational workflows within modern organizations. It's not just another project management tool; it's a bridge between the complex dynamics of today's business landscape and the simplicity of classical task management principles, akin to the clarity once appreciated in earlier corporate environments.
KanBo's prowess lies in its ability to align technology with human factors, offering a platform where Director of Software Engineering can navigate complexities with the ease of a bygone era’s best leaders.
Bold and Non-Standard Solutions
Reimagining Governance and Accountability
KanBo equips software engineering directors with real-time visibility into the governance and accountability of coding decisions, control obligations, and success metrics such as cost of ownership and maintainability. By facilitating a transparent environment where every decision and task is traceable through cards and activity streams, leaders can confidently hold themselves accountable and maintain integrity across their teams and processes.
Flexible Resource Management in Real-time
With the unique ability to manage both on-premises and cloud environments, KanBo offers directors unprecedented flexibility in resource allocation and budget management. By visualizing workflows and card dependencies within Spaces, managers can assess resource needs dynamically, adapting quickly to shifting project demands without compromising on strategic goals. The integration with Microsoft environments further aids in efficient resource deployment, as crucial data can be directly accessed and utilized global teams without security risks.
Enhancing Multi-Domain Technical Solutions
KanBo's hierarchical structure of Workspaces, Spaces, and Cards offers a versatile platform where technical solutions can be developed and refined collaboratively. By transforming project strategies into actionable items, it empowers software engineers to devise solutions that transcend domain-specific applications. Using Space Templates and Card Templates, successful strategies and technical frameworks can be replicated across multiple units, creating a decentralized reservoir of best practices.
Cross-Domain Influence on a Unified Platform
By creating unified pathways of communication and collaboration, KanBo facilitates synergistic interactions across teams, steering cross-functional leadership influence. For example, project management can be orchestrated with real-time input from diverse departments, ensuring alignment with business, product, and technology directives. By leveraging KanBo Spaces, directors can directly influence operational nuances without bypassing collaborative structures.
Tackling Next-Generation Problems with KanBo
Diversity and Inclusion in Problem-Solving
KanBo champions diversity, equity, and inclusion through an architecture designed for open and respectful dialogue. Spaces serve as an open forum where diverse voices can contribute to a collaborative endeavor, ensuring that visionary problem-solving benefits from a multitude of perspectives—a crucial factor in tackling the next-gen problems.
Optimizing Customer Onboarding
In sectors such as finance, where reducing customer onboarding times is vital, KanBo plays a crucial role. By using its intuitive workflow and communication features, organizations can streamline onboarding processes, allowing for real-time status monitoring and flexible adaptation of strategies. External stakeholders can be seamlessly integrated into these processes through KanBo's external user invitation feature, ensuring the most current and comprehensive input is available at every stage.
Adaptation to Flexible Work Environments
As directors explore flexible work arrangements, KanBo provides the infrastructure for adaptable workspaces that accommodate diverse working models. Its platform unites individuals who may be separated by geography or time zones, ensuring that tasks remain on course, and collaboration continues unhindered by physical boundaries. This adaptability is key to maintaining agility in an ever-evolving business environment.
Inspiring and Less Obvious Insights
Clarifying the Complex with Elegance
KanBo merges complexity with elegance by translating intricate project elements into organized and simplified visual representations. Directors can move away from convoluted spreadsheets and dense communications, stepping into a world where information flows as naturally as it would have in simpler corporate times. Its card-based metaphor makes the intangible tangible, rendering the management of modern complexities intuitive and human-centric.
Envisioning the Future of Work
As enterprises confront the future's unknown challenges, KanBo’s collaborative and customizable infrastructure positions it as more than just a supportive tool; it's an enabler of innovation and an architect of progress. By continually embracing new opportunities within its platform, KanBo helps organizations find clarity in ambition and precision in execution, setting new benchmarks for excellence in digital infrastructure.
In conclusion, KanBo serves as a robust digital infrastructure, navigating the intricacies of modern organizations while empowering leadership to craft meaningful, efficient, and visionary solutions for the challenges of today and tomorrow.
Implementing KanBo for complex work management: A step-by-step guide
KanBo Implementation Cookbook for Director of Software Engineering
The Director of Software Engineering plays a critical role in ensuring that every project aligns with the organization’s strategic objectives. KanBo provides a robust infrastructure to streamline this process.
Understanding KanBo Features and Principles
1. KanBo Cards (Context and Memory):
- Capture and document vital information with notes, files, comments, and checklists.
- Maintain dynamic activity streams providing real-time logs of actions.
2. Interconnected Card Relations:
- Use parent-child and next-previous relations to organize tasks efficiently.
3. Structured Workspaces and Spaces:
- Arrange Workspaces and Spaces to represent different projects or teams.
4. User-Specific Responsibilities:
- Assign roles to team members, such as Person Responsible and Co-Worker.
Business Problem Analysis
Challenge: Aligning software development tasks with strategic business objectives while ensuring efficient team collaboration and task delegation.
Step-by-Step Solution for Director of Software Engineering
Step 1: Set Up the Hierarchy (Workspaces, Folders, and Spaces)
1. Create a Workspace:
- Go to the main dashboard and click on the plus icon (+) or "Create New Workspace."
- Name the Workspace according to the project or team focus.
2. Set Security and Permissions:
- Decide if the Workspace is Private, Public, or Org-wide.
- Assign roles - Owner, Member, or Visitor - according to team structure.
3. Organize Folders:
- Within the Workspace, add Folders to categorize Spaces.
- Consider structure based on client, feature set, or team function.
Step 2: Developing Spaces for Projects or Focus Areas
1. Create Spaces:
- Determine the nature of the project (e.g., Structured, Informational, Multi-dimensional).
- Set roles for team members, ensuring accountability.
2. Customize Workflow:
- Define status categories such as To Do, Doing, and Done.
- Utilize informational elements where necessary to ensure clarity.
Step 3: Implement Task Management with Cards
1. Add and Customize Cards:
- Create cards for every task or actionable item.
- Include all needed information like deadlines, notes, and relevant files.
2. Establish Card Relations:
- Use parent-child and next-previous relations to delineate task order.
- Ensure the project’s large-scale objectives are broken into smaller, actionable components.
3. Assign Card Responsibilities:
- Clearly assign the Person Responsible and Co-Workers to each card.
- Ensure roles are visible and understood by team members.
Step 4: Enhance Communication and Coordination
1. Use the Activity Stream:
- Monitor real-time progress and encourage the team to use this for updates.
2. Encourage Comments and Mentions:
- Use the commenting feature for team discussions and questions.
- Mention team members to gain immediate feedback.
3. Integrate Email Communications:
- Set up email notifications and address tasks through KanBo’s email integration.
Step 5: Monitor and Evaluation
1. Track Progress with Filters and Grouping:
- Use filtering options to view specific tasks or progress points.
- Group cards based on their workflow status or deadlines.
2. Forecast and Time Charts:
- Leverage the Forecast and Time Chart features to visualize project timelines and assess workflow efficiencies.
3. Conduct Regular Review Meetings:
- Schedule routine evaluations to ensure that Workspaces align with organizational strategies.
- Adjust structures and roles as needed to improve efficiency.
By following this Cookbook-style guide, the Director of Software Engineering can ensure that software development processes are aligned with strategic objectives, using KanBo to facilitate a streamlined, collaborative approach to project management.
Glossary and terms
Glossary of Key KanBo Terms
Introduction
KanBo is an advanced platform that enhances work coordination and aligns it seamlessly with overarching company strategies. Unlike traditional SaaS applications, KanBo offers a hybrid environment, integrating easily with Microsoft products, which provides greater customization, data management, and compliance capabilities. This glossary elucidates key KanBo terms essential for understanding and maximizing the use of the platform.
---
Key Terms
- Workspace
- A top-tier group organizing related spaces tied to specific projects, teams, or topics.
- Allows for manageable navigation and collaboration by gathering all relevant spaces.
- Access and privacy are controllable by users, consolidating team involvement.
- Space
- A collection of cards representing specific projects or focus areas.
- Highly customizable to visually depict workflows.
- Facilitates collaborative work and effective task management in a digital setting.
- Card
- The fundamental unit in KanBo, representing tasks or items requiring tracking and management.
- Includes critical information like notes, files, comments, dates, and checklists.
- Flexible structure allows adaptation to various scenarios.
- Activity Stream
- A dynamic and interactive feed listing activities in a chronological sequence.
- Serves as a real-time log, detailing what happened, when, and by whom.
- Provides links to related cards and spaces for effortless navigation. Each card, space, and user possesses their unique activity stream.
- Card Relation
- Connections between cards creating dependencies and clarifying task sequences.
- Breaks down large tasks into manageable components.
- Two primary types: parent-child and next-previous.
- Card User
- Users assigned to specific cards within KanBo.
- Includes the "Person Responsible" tasked with completing the card, and possible Co-Workers.
- All card users are updated via notifications on every card action.
Understanding these terms enables effective utilization of KanBo, facilitating streamlined project management and strategic alignment. Leveraging these elements helps ensure projects are managed efficiently and strategically aligned with organizational goals.